Load Bearing: Main crankshaft bearings withstand the relentless forces exerted by the combustion process and the twisting motion of the crankshaft, preventing excessive wear and premature failure.
Alignment and Positioning: These bearings serve as precision guides, maintaining the crankshaft's alignment within the engine block, ensuring optimal performance and longevity.
Friction Reduction: By minimizing friction between the crankshaft and the engine block, main crankshaft bearings enhance engine efficiency and reduce premature wear.
Vibration Dampening: Their inherent ability to absorb vibrations helps mitigate noise and smooth engine operation, enhancing overall comfort and refinement.

Wear and Tear: Over time, main crankshaft bearings endure constant friction and stress, leading to wear and tear. Regular maintenance and timely replacement can mitigate these effects, ensuring extended bearing life.
Insufficient Lubrication: Inadequate lubrication can starve the bearings of essential oil, resulting in increased friction and premature failure. Maintaining proper oil levels and adhering to recommended oil change intervals is crucial for optimal bearing performance.
Misalignment: Incorrect installation or engine misalignment can induce excessive stress on the bearings, leading to diminished lifespan. Ensuring proper bearing alignment during assembly and regular engine inspections is paramount.

Regular Maintenance: Adhering to the recommended maintenance schedule, including timely oil changes and inspections, plays a pivotal role in extending the lifespan of your main crankshaft bearings.
High-Quality Oil: Investing in high-quality engine oil specifically designed for your vehicle ensures optimal lubrication and minimizes wear.
Proper Installation: Precision is paramount during bearing installation. Follow manufacturer guidelines meticulously to avoid misalignment and ensure proper bearing seating.
Torque Specifications: Tightening bolts to the specified torque ensures proper bearing alignment and prevents excessive stress.

Overtightening Nuts: Excessive torque on bearing cap nuts can induce excessive stress on the bearings, leading to premature failure.
Incorrect Bearing Clearance: Insufficient or excessive bearing clearance can jeopardize proper lubrication and alignment, compromising bearing performance.
Neglecting Maintenance: Ignoring regular maintenance can result in insufficient lubrication, leading to accelerated wear and bearing failure.

Cause | Description |
---|---|
Insufficient Lubrication | Lack of adequate oil supply to the bearings |
Excessive Wear | Prolonged use and friction leading to bearing surface degradation |
Misalignment | Incorrect installation or engine deformation inducing bearing stress |
Overheating | Extreme temperatures causing bearing material softening and failure |
Contamination | Foreign particles in the oil damaging bearing surfaces |
Symptom | Description |
---|---|
Knocking Sounds | Distinctive rhythmic noise emanating from the engine |
Reduced Oil Pressure | Insufficient oil pressure reaching the bearings |
Metal Shavings in Oil | Visible metal particles in the engine oil |
Engine Overheating | Inefficient bearing lubrication leading to increased friction and heat |
Oil Leaks | Worn or damaged bearings causing oil to seep out of the engine |
